According to the manual, enabling a clock requires setting the CPG_CLK_ON bit and verifying the clock has started using the CPG_CLK_MON bit. Similarly, disabling a clock requires clearing the CPG_CLK_ON bit and confirming the clock has stopped via the CPG_CLK_MON bit. Modify `rzv2h_mod_clock_is_enabled()` to check CLK_MON first and then validate CLK_ON for a more accurate clock status evaluation.
